Mauchline hails Bard’s birthday
SOME of the best Burns events you’ll see anywhere are held in Mauchline.
And the wee town hosted another cracking event for the Bard‘s 251st birthday.
Families took advantage of the many fantastic free events on offer during the day.
These included Hopscotch Theatre Company’s production of Tam o’ Shanter.
There was also puppet-making by Clydebuilt Puppet Theatre.
And some incredible story-telling from Tony Bonning.
All these events took place within the Burns House Museum.
But there was more going on outside in the churchyard and in Castle Street.
East Ayrshire Council’s Arts and Museums organised the event, which continues to grow in popularity.
